Game 3, 1:10pm

Odrisamer Despaigne (3-5, 4.83 ERA) vs. Chase Anderson (3-2, 3.54 ERA)

Aside from a hiccup in Oakland, Despaigne has been one of the best pitchers on this staff in the last few weeks. He has allowed two runs or less in 5 of his last 7 starts. However, the last time he pitched against the Diamondbacks it did not go well. He allowed 8 runs on 10 hits in 5 innings. He has a 4.21 ERA in 6 starts against the D-backs.

David Peralta seems to have Despaigne’s number, hitting .462 against him.

Anderson last faced the Padres on May 9th and pitched well. He went 7 innings while only allowing one run. In his two seasons in the big leagues, he has faced the Padres 5 times. He is 2-1 with a 3.21 ERA. Matt Kemp is 4 for 11 with a home run and four RBI against Anderson.

The Friars desperately need a series win here. I think they will get it. The offense is riding some momentum after the Giants series when they scored 6 runs in one inning on Thursday. As they hit the halfway mark into the 2015 season, they need to turn things around real fast if they have any hopes of October baseball. The NL West has weakened in the past month which still leaves the door open for San Diego. They must take advantage.
